Is GENARO GARCIA HERNANDEZ safe to work with?

Is GENARO GARCIA HERNANDEZ safe to load? GENARO GARCIA HERNANDEZ (USDOT 2141718, MX-745411) is an active small-fleet motor carrier based in NUEVO LAREDO, TA, operating 5 power units and 5 drivers. Operating authority has been active 15 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 88 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 33.9% (above the 22.26% national average), with 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it review before loading (68/100), with the leading concern: no insurance on file.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
